#783435 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#783435 is composed of 47.1% red, 20.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.7% magenta, 55.8%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 359.1 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 33.7%. #783435 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0686a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#783435 color description : Dark moderate red.
#783435 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#783435 has RGB values of R:120, G:52,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.56,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7877685.

Shades and Tints of #783435
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0505 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.
